Frequently asked

About Heritage Middle School
How large is Heritage Middle School?
Heritage Middle School enrolls approximately 1,009 students in grades 07-08.
Is Heritage Middle School an elementary, middle, or high school?
Heritage Middle School is a middle school covering grades 07-08.
How many teachers does Heritage Middle School have?
Heritage Middle School employs 85 FTE teachers, for a student-to-teacher ratio of 11.9:1.
What is the racial breakdown of students at Heritage Middle School?
At Heritage Middle School, the student body is approximately 48% White, 5% Hispanic, 5% Black, 39% Asian, 3% Two or more.
Who oversees Heritage Middle School?
Heritage Middle School is overseen by Livingston Board of Education School District in Essex County.
